I'm thinking of booking next trip in a deluxe for the first time vs our usual pattern of values and moderates. Discount for this will obviously be much more impactful!

Disney still has seasonal rates, right? Meaning Christmas rooms are more expensive than February, even without a special offer? If so, are the RO offers discounted from that season's already-lower rate, or from full rack rate? Which means that 30% discount is a little misleading considering few ever pay full rack rate & would really compare that room's price to the non-"special offer" seasonal rate available at that time. Hope this makes sense.

Just trying to plan ahead and wondering whether to look at historical discount charts or seasonal regular pricing to help gauge times of year and get decent rough numbers for budgeting. Thanks!

Yes, they have seasonal rates - but the seasonal rate IS the rack rate. So even though it's $130 in Feb vs $250 during a holiday, the $130 is still the rack rate for that time frame. That is what the discount will come off of, not the highest possible rate for the room.

That is one approach and it can work. But remember you may have to be flexible because discounts are always based on availability, so there is no guarantee that you will be able to get the offered discount for your specific room.

I am not sure if allears has the historical discounts but I have seen them on mousesavers.
